Source: International Space Station Expedition 38 crew member Koichi Wakata This image is so beautiful I just had to share it — a sweet piece of visual eye candy to help us all start the week with the right frame of mind. Koichi Wakata, a JAXA astronaut aboard the International Space Station, shot this photograph of the moon floating above the Earth's glowing limb on Feb. 21. Enjoy! And have a great week.
